This feature takes a snapshot of the operating system before and after a new software installation. By comparing the two states, Revo creates a precise log of every file added and registry key modified, ensuring a complete reversal if the application is removed later. 4. Revo Uninstaller has a unique history with Windows XP, as the operating system was a core focus for the tool's early development. While modern versions have largely moved on, specific older versions remain essential for XP users who need a deep-cleaning utility that the native "Add/Remove Programs" tool lacks. Windows XP remains a legendary operating system, still utilized today in specialized industries, legacy gaming setups, and retro computing environments. However, managing software on this classic platform presents unique challenges, particularly regarding system clutter and registry bloat. Standard uninstallation routines often leave behind digital debris that degrades performance over time.
